The History of the Treadmill

The treadmill is a common feature in a lot of fitness rooms and gyms. It is also a popular piece of equipment in households across the globe. What many people don't realize is that treadmills have a long, varied history. It was used to punish as well as a tool for construction, and even as an instrument for medical use. It has seen a lot of changes in the past that it's hard to imagine what the treadmill might look like in the future.

Sir William Cubitt, an English civil engineer, invented the first modern treadmill in 1818. He was trying to improve the conditions of British prisons at the time, and believed that prisoners could be made to work harder. Cubitt's idea was that a human-powered device like the wheel you walk on, whose cogs lock to keep prisoners active throughout the day. His tread-wheel was a huge, broad wheel that prisoners pressed their feet on.

The machine was so effective that it quickly was the focus of reformers in prisons. According to the British Library a group called the Society for the Improvement of Prison Discipline seized on the idea and began using the machine in prisons. In the summer, prisoners would work on the machines for 10 hours a day. In winter, they worked seven hours. The program was so successful that it was adopted by prisons all over the world.

The JLL T350 Digital Folding Treadmill

The JLL T350 is a high quality treadmill that is ideal for anyone who is determined to get fit and would like to do it in the at-home comfort of their home. It is powerful enough (both in terms of speed and incline) to appeal to advanced runners, yet is friendly enough to get beginners on the treadmill too. It also offers a comfortable and well cushioned running surface that goes smooth on joints and provides an amazing workout.

2-in-1-folding-treadmill-flylinktech-home-quiet-treadmill-with-bluetooth-control-wide-running-belt-transport-wheels-14-km-h-12-exercise-modes-lcd-display-two-year-warranty-28.jpgThe treadmill is easy to fold and put away. It has wheels that make it easy to move around the room. The frame is durable and is strong enough to withstand vigorous use and the large safety bars that rise from the front of the display area are a nice addition. It weighs quite a amount at 59kg, and will need a helping hand to set it in place when first setting it up, but once you have done that it is easy to use and maintain.

The huge LCD screen of 5 inches may look outdated, but it's very effective. It displays all the important workout metrics in a clear and concise way. It displays your time, distance travelled as well as your heartbeat, speed and calories burned. You can choose among 20 different professional running programs that are pre-programmed. The knob for incline, which is conveniently located on the handrails allows you to alter the intensity of the workout.

This treadmill is powered by an 4.5HP engine and has a maximum speed of 18km/h, which is enough to satisfy even the most experienced runners. The cushioned deck is extremely comfortable and the 16-point cushioning system does a fantastic job of keeping your ankles and knees comfortable while you run.

The console features an USB interface port as well as bluetooth wireless connectivity that allows users to connect their iPhone, iPod or MP3 player and play music while exercising. The JLL T350 also features built in speakers so you can catch up on your favorite podcasts while working out. Lastly, if you require a break, you can hit the Pause button and then return to where you left off when you are ready.
